Output 950b038aef4c32a428f74354de3c9335b062a6b4faf819c03cbc2a74f88d7b5e:20

value
4058961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3076be7d3ca8af2dba0256bce03beb839725b2bd OP_EQUAL
address
367GcEetDzzHq5JnowN3UJXzQnSNZpunQi
transaction
950b038aef4c32a428f74354de3c9335b062a6b4faf819c03cbc2a74f88d7b5e
confirmations
370872
spent
true